When working with Rosiglitazone, a prescription medicine that belongs to the thiazolidinedione class and acts as a PPARγ agonist to improve the body’s response to insulin. Also known as Avandia, it is used primarily to lower blood sugar in people with type 2 diabetes. Rosiglitazone works by binding to the peroxisome proliferator‑activated receptor‑gamma (PPARγ) in fat and muscle cells, which boosts the storage of glucose and reduces insulin resistance. The drug’s impact on insulin sensitivity makes it a valuable option when diet, exercise, and first‑line meds don’t keep glucose in check, but its profile also ties directly to heart health, liver function, and possible drug interactions.
One of the most important related entities is thiazolidinediones, a group of oral antidiabetic agents that share the PPARγ activation mechanism. This class includes drugs like pioglitazone and rosiglitazone, and all of them require regular monitoring of liver enzymes because they are metabolized in the liver. Another core entity is type 2 diabetes, a chronic condition characterized by high blood sugar due to insulin resistance and relative insulin deficiency. Managing this disease often starts with lifestyle changes, then metformin, and finally, if needed, a thiazolidinedione to tackle the underlying insulin resistance. A third related concept is cardiovascular risk, the likelihood of heart‑related events such as heart attack or stroke, which can be influenced by blood sugar control and drug side‑effects. Studies have shown rosiglitazone can raise LDL cholesterol while lowering triglycerides, so doctors weigh these changes against the drug’s glucose‑lowering benefits. Finally, drug interactions, situations where rosiglitazone’s effectiveness or safety is altered by other medications matter a lot; combining it with certain CYP2C8 inhibitors or other antidiabetic drugs can increase the risk of hypoglycemia or liver strain.
